For heavy dining chairs on tile, the safest floor protector is usually one that fits the chair leg securely, keeps grit away from the tile, and matches how often the chair is moved. Felt, nylon, rubber, and mechanical glides all behave differently, so choose by use case rather than by a universal “best” label.
First identify the tile surface
Glazed ceramic, porcelain, natural stone, textured tile, and sealed tile can respond differently to contact materials and cleaners. If the floor manufacturer has guidance for furniture glides or pads, follow that first.
For natural stone or specialty finishes, avoid assuming that rubber, adhesives, or plastic are automatically safe. Some compounds can stain or react with sealers.
Then measure the chair legs
Measure the actual contact point of each leg. Round, square, tapered, angled, and metal-tube legs may need different protector styles.
- Measure width or diameter at the floor.
- Check whether the leg is hollow metal, solid wood, plastic, or another material.
- Inspect the bottom for existing nails, glides, or threaded inserts.
- Choose a protector designed for that attachment method.
Felt pads: good for frequent movement
Dense felt can work well when dining chairs are pulled in and out regularly because it allows relatively smooth movement and reduces direct abrasion.
The main weakness is dirt. Grit can become embedded in felt and turn the pad into an abrasive surface. Inspect and clean or replace felt regularly.
Adhesive felt is convenient but can detach under repeated lateral movement. Nail-on, screw-on, or replaceable-cap systems may stay in place better when they are compatible with the chair construction.
Nylon or hard-plastic glides
Low-friction nylon or plastic glides can be durable and easy to move, especially on metal or wood legs with compatible sockets or inserts. They should have a smooth, undamaged contact face and should not expose fasteners as they wear.
Check the tile manufacturer’s guidance before using a hard glide on a highly polished or delicate surface.
Rubber or non-slip feet
Rubber-style protectors are better when the goal is to stop a chair from sliding rather than make it glide. This can be useful for stationary benches or chairs that should stay put.
Because rubber compounds vary, confirm compatibility with the tile or sealer and watch for discoloration during the first weeks of use.
Swivel and mechanical glides
Swivel glides can help angled chair legs maintain flatter contact with the floor. They are useful when a fixed glide would touch the tile only at one edge.
Use the size and installation method specified by the glide manufacturer. Do not drill or screw into a chair leg unless the furniture construction can safely accept that hardware.
Weight ratings: use manufacturer data, not generic rules
There is no reliable universal chair-weight threshold that determines when felt, nylon, or metal must be used. A protector’s performance depends on its material, contact area, attachment, chair geometry, and the floor beneath it.
If a product publishes a load rating, use that manufacturer rating. Avoid homemade “per-leg” calculations unless the product documentation specifically supports them.
Keep the contact surface clean
Most scratches happen when hard grit is dragged between the chair and floor. Vacuum or sweep the dining area regularly and inspect protectors for trapped debris.
Replace any glide that has become rough, cracked, compressed, detached, or worn through.
Quick comparison
| Protector type | Best use | Main maintenance issue |
|---|---|---|
| Dense felt | Chairs moved often | Collects grit and compresses |
| Nylon/plastic glide | Smooth, durable movement | Inspect for rough wear |
| Rubber/non-slip foot | Keeping furniture in place | Check floor compatibility |
| Swivel glide | Angled or uneven leg contact | Check attachment and rotation |
| Replaceable-cap system | High-use chairs | Replace worn contact caps |
Installation basics
Clean the bottom of each chair leg before fitting a protector. Follow the manufacturer’s instructions for adhesives, inserts, screws, or snap-on systems.
Avoid overdriving screws into wood, forcing an undersized cap onto a leg, or using adhesives not intended for the furniture material.
Bottom line
For most heavy dining chairs that move frequently on tile, start with a securely attached dense felt or smooth manufacturer-approved glide, then inspect it regularly for grit and wear. If the chair should not move, a compatible non-slip foot may be better.
